From: hjc Date: Fri, 29 Aug 2014 06:17:55 +0000 (+0800) Subject: rk3036 hdmi: fix audio abnormal when change video mode X-Git-Tag: firefly_0821_release~4769^2~33 X-Git-Url: http://demsky.eecs.uci.edu/git/?a=commitdiff_plain;h=ee1203ab36cdfd2cbb2a0e371012b36b827f7811;p=firefly-linux-kernel-4.4.55.git rk3036 hdmi: fix audio abnormal when change video mode --- diff --git a/dr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.c b/dr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.c index 0dc40621f00d..f81296cd5da2 100755 --- a/dr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.c +++ b/dr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.c @@ -515,6 +515,7 @@ void rk3036_hdmi_control_output(struct hdmi *hdmi_drv, int enable) } rk3036_hdmi_sys_power(hdmi_drv, true); rk3036_hdmi_sys_power(hdmi_drv, false); + delay100us(); rk3036_hdmi_sys_power(hdmi_drv, true); hdmi_writel(hdmi_dev, 0xce, 0x00); delay100us();